In a recent decision, the Northern District of Texas, Dallas Division, granted a health care provider a preliminary injunction to prevent the Centers for Medicare & Medicaid Services ("CMS") from withholding Medicare payments due to an alleged overpayment while the provider awaits its Administrative Law Judge ("ALJ") hearing on the issue. In this episode, Susan Hackney discusses the appeals process for Medicare claim disputes, how the district court reached its decision in this case, and what effects this outcome may have on the process going forward.
